Crystal structure of A. aeolicus tRNASec in complex with M. kandleri SerRS

Function

[SYS2_METKA] Catalyzes the attachment of serine to tRNA(Ser). Is also able to aminoacylate tRNA(Sec) with serine, to form the misacylated tRNA L-seryl-tRNA(Sec), which will be further converted into selenocysteinyl-tRNA(Sec) (By similarity).

About this Structure

3w3s is a 2 chain structure with sequence from Methanopyrus kandleri av19.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
